Nevada is home to 15k nonprofit organizations. In aggregate, these organizations account for $12b in revenue and employ 58.7k individuals.

MISSION:
SHINE A LIGHT IS A 501(C)3 NON PROFIT HOMELESS OUTREACH AND PLACEMENT SERVICE THAT HELPS THE HUNDREDS OF HOMELESS MEN, WOMEN AND CHILDREN IN THE GREATER LAS VEGAS AREA. OUR PRIMARY FOCUS IS INDIVIDUALS WHO LIVE IN THE UNDERGROUND FLOOD CHANNELS OF LAS VEGAS. THE PROGRAM PRIDES ITSELF ON GOING INTO THE DEPTHS OF THE STORMDRAIN SYSTEM AND ENGAGING THIS UNDERSERVED, HIDDEN POPULATION ON A PERSONAL LEVEL.
